Estimated Repair Cost
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$3,500 - $7,000 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or foundation crack repair |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Foundation underpinning | $4,000 - $8,000 |
| Full foundation replacement | $20,000 - $50,000 |
| Basement wall stabilization | $3,500 - $7,000 |
| Pier and beam foundation repair | $2,500 - $6,000 |
| Crawl space stabilization |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Key Cost Influencers
Cracked foundations in Chapel Hill, TN, can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ture issues. Repair projects vary based on the extent of damage and specific site conditions.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and comparing options for foundation repair services.
- Materials used: Common materials include concrete, steel piers, and helical anchors, selected based on soil conditions and structural needs.
- Size and scope: Repairs can range from small cracks to extensive underpinning of entire foundation sections.
- Labor complexity: The complexity depends on the foundation type, extent of damage, and accessibility of the site, influencing overall labor requirements.
- Permitting considerations: Local regulations in Chapel Hill may require permits for foundation stabilization or underpinning projects.
- Additional options: Services may include waterproofing, drainage improvements, or moisture barriers as part of comprehensive foundation stabilization.
Repair Size and Extent
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small cracks and minor settling |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Moderate foundation cracks and wall bowing | $3,000 - $7,000 |
| Major foundation settlement or significant cracking | $7,000 - $15,000 |
| Extensive underpinning and stabilization | $15,000 and up |
